What industry-specific factors are fueling the growth of the airway clearance devices for cystic fibrosis market?
The rise in lung diseases is anticipated to spur the expansion of the cystic fibrosis airway clearance devices industry. Lung diseases are characterized by increased mucus output and lung function impairment, resulting in an escalating need for successful methods to clear airways and enhance respiratory health. The escalating occurrence of lung disorders can be connected to numerous intertwined elements, including escalating air contamination and the consumption of tobacco and cigarettes, both of which make a significant contribution to respiratory illnesses and lasting lung damage. Airway clearance devices like high-frequency chest wall oscillation (HFCWO) vests, positive expiratory pressure (PEP) machines, and oscillatory PEP machines, are essential for clearing thick mucus from the airways, particularly crucial for cystic fibrosis individuals whose unusually thick and sticky mucus results in chronic lung infections and breathing issues. For instance, according to the Centers for Disease Control and Prevention, a US government agency, the number of tuberculosis cases heightened from 8,320 in 2022 to 9,615 in 2023, indicating an increase of 1,295 cases. Therefore, the increase in lung disorders will fuel the growth of the cystic fibrosis airway clearance devices industry.

What Is the projected market size and growth rate for the airway clearance devices for cystic fibrosis market?
Over the past few years, the market for airway clearance devices for the treatment of cystic fibrosis has significantly expanded. The market, which stood at $2.59 billion in 2024, is expected to reach $2.76 billion in 2025, marking a compound annual growth rate (CAGR) of 6.3%. The notable growth observed in the historical phase can be attributed to factors such as the rising occurrence of cystic fibrosis, supportive healthcare policies from government bodies, an increase in healthcare infrastructure, the expansion of healthcare insurance coverage, and a surge in the incidence of respiratory diseases.

The market for airway clearance devices used in the treatment of cystic fibrosis is projected to experience substantial growth in the upcoming years. It's estimated to escalate to a worth of $3.48 billion in 2029, with a compounded annual growth rate (CAGR) of 6.0%. This growth during the forecast period is largely due to factors like the rising incidence of chronic respiratory ailments, an expanding elderly demographic, the advancement in combination treatments, an increased preference for non-invasive therapy methods, and the expanding application of personalized healthcare. Major tendencies during this projected period comprise of technological progression, tailor-made therapies, wearable gadget development, combined treatments, and the incorporation of artificial intelligence.

What new trends are reshaping the airway clearance devices for cystic fibrosis market and its opportunities?
Prevailing firms in the cystic fibrosis airway clearance devices market are concentrating on technological enhancements like high-frequency chest wall oscillation technology. These advancements help to increase mucus clearance efficiency, heighten patient comfort, diminish treatment duration, and offer non-intrusive treatment choices at home, leading to improved clinical results and life quality for cystic fibrosis patients. High-frequency chest wall oscillation technology is a treatment method that uses quick air pulses to generate vibrations on the chest wall, aiding in loosening and moving mucus for easy removal from the lungs. For example, in September 2024, Baxter International Inc., a healthcare organization based in the US, unveiled its latest airway clearance system, the Vest Advanced Pulmonary Experience (APX) System, at the North American Cystic Fibrosis Conference. The Vest APX System maintains the reliable airflow technology of its previous model but includes enhanced comfort and patient-centric features developed from both clinician and patient feedback. This system is geared towards providing daily therapy for adults and children suffering from specific chronic lung conditions and retained secretions.

Which region dominates the airway clearance devices for cystic fibrosis market?
North America was the largest region in the airway clearance devices for cystic fibrosis market in 2024. Asia-Pacific is expected to be the fastest-growing region in the forecast period.
